Product Details of [ 925677-89-0 ]

CAS No. :925677-89-0
Formula : C10H8FN3
M.W : 189.19
SMILES Code : NC1=NC(C2=CC=CC(F)=C2)=CN=C1
MDL No. :MFCD12033125

YieldReaction ConditionsOperation in experiment
95% With sodium carbonate;tetrakis(triphenylphosphine) palladium(0); In ethanol; water; toluene; at 110℃; for 4h; 6-(3-Fluorophenyl)pyrazin-2-amine To a stirred solution of <strong>[33332-28-4]2-amino-6-chloropyrazine</strong> (2.0 g, 15.43 mmol) in a mixture of toluene (90 ml.) and ethanol (8.5 ml_) was added 3-fluorophenyl boronic acid (2.60 g, 18.51 mmol) and a 2M aqueous solution of sodium carbonate (16.2 mL, 32.40 mmol). The mixture was subjected to three cycles of evacuation-backfilling with argon, and tetrakis(triphenylphosphine)palladium (0.713 g, 0.617 mmol) was added. The mixture was subjected again to three cycles of evacuation-backfilling with argon the flask was capped and placed in a 11O0C oil bath. After 4h, the mixture was cooled, partitioned between dichloromethane and water the organic layer was washed with brine, dried (MgSO4) and evaporated. The residue was purified by silica gel flash chromatography (33percent ethyl acetate in hexanes to 50percent ethyl acetate in hexanes). Concentration in vaccuo of the product-rich fractions provided the titled compound (2.79 g, 95percent) as a yellowish solid (2.79 g, 95percent). delta 1H-NMR (CDCI3): 8.38 (s, 1 H), 7.95 (s, 1H), 7.60 (m, 2H), 7.40 (m, 1 H), 4.65 (s, 2H).

YieldReaction ConditionsOperation in experiment
39% With caesium carbonate;dichloro(1,1'-bis(diphenylphosphanyl)ferrocene)palladium(II)*CH2Cl2; In 1,4-dioxane; water; at 150℃; for 0.166667h; 5-(3-Chloropyridin-4-yl)-6-(3-fluorophenyl)pyrazin-2-amine A microwave oven reactor was charged with 5-bromo-6-(3-fluorophenyl)pyrazin-2-amine (Preparation 1 , 0.3 g, 1.11 mmol), <strong>[458532-98-4](3-chloropyridin-4-yl)boronic acid</strong> (212 mg, 1.03 mmol), [1 ,1'-bis(diphenylphosphino)ferrocene] palladium(ll)dichloride dichloromethane complex (1:1) (39 mg, 0.047 mmol), dioxane (8 ml_) and a 1.2M aqueous solution of cesium carbonate was added (1.9 ml_, 2.39 mmol). The mixture was heated to 15O0C for 10min in the microwave oven, then cooled, partitioned between water and ethyl acetate, the aqueous phase extracted twice with ethyl acetate, the organic layers washed with brine, dried (MgSO4) and evaporated. Flash chromatography (dichloromethane to dichloromethane/methanol 90:10) furnished the title compound as a yellowish solid (78 mg, 39%). delta 1H-NMR (CDCI3): 8.55 (s, 1 H)1 8.45 (d, 1H), 8.05 (s, 1H), 7.30 (d, 1H), 7.15 (m,2H), 7.00 (m, 2H), 4.85 (bs, 2H).ESI/MS m/e: 301 ([M+H] C15H10CIFN4) Retention time (min.): 12
